Transaction 38efff5908e435a2fb3349284928f7a8b6bfeda1551c2e8cab2a7a4fbc3fc30d
3 Input
2 Outputs
- 38efff5908e435a2fb3349284928f7a8b6bfeda1551c2e8cab2a7a4fbc3fc30d:0
- 38efff5908e435a2fb3349284928f7a8b6bfeda1551c2e8cab2a7a4fbc3fc30d:1
value 32793440
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 2168533
address 1MPPhWLeQXovuRkg5MVKfiKQe3PVDkS7nA